Ultimately boundedness and stability of triply diffusive mixtures in rotating porous layers under the action of Brinkman law
چکیده انگلیسی

The long-time behavior of triply fluid mixtures saturating horizontal porous layers uniformly rotating around the vertical axis, according to the Brinkman law (holding for large pores), is investigated. The most destabilizing case of layers heated from below and salted from above by two salts, is considered. The ultimately boundedness of the solutions (existence of absorbing sets) is shown. A necessary and sufficient condition guaranteeing the global non-linear asymptotic L2L2-stability of the conduction solution is obtained.
